There are a few terms you need to be familiar with. TALK TIME: The total amount phone use, typically measured in minutes, for both calls placed and calls received. PEAK MINUTES: Talk time minutes used during the prime calling periods when the carrier networks are most active, typically between 6am and 9pm Monday through Friday. OFF PEAK MINUTES: Talk Time minutes used outside of prime calling periods. ROAMING: Wireless phone used outside of a customer's home calling area or carrier network coverage. MOBILE-TO-MOBILE MINUTES: Minutes used for calling or receiving calls from another customer on your carrier's service network.

State Boards All dentists must be registered with the state Board of Dental Examiners. They can provide you with a list of dentists, or you can find this online as most states make the list easily available on their website. You should be able to do a simple search for your dentist`s name and the following information will be made available.

- Address - Phone number - License number - License issue date - End of record mark

The number that concerns you here is the license number. You can use this to get further information about the dentist you are interested in by contacting the state Board of Dental Examiners. In some states, this can be done online, but in many, you`ll need to actually call the board up.

With the license number, you`ll be able to find out if the dentist has a valid license and if any disciplinary measures have ever been taken against him or her. You will need the number for your particular state`s board so you can call them up and ask for information about the dentist in question. Any other problems with their practice will be available to you, as well, so you can make your choice as to whether or not you`ll make an appointment with that particular dentist London Ontario. If you are checking out more than one dentist, be sure to have all the license numbers on hand for reference.

Limitations on health plans should be understood, so you know when you need the other options availible to you like Travel medical Insurance, temporary health insurance and Gap health insurance.

Temporary Health Insurance is not the same as short term health insurance.

Short term health insurance is really designed to provide basic major medical benefits for a SHORT ammount of known time. An example would be if you have started a new job, and you know your benefits do not start for 90 days, you buy 90 days worth of SHORT TERM HEALTH INSURANCE, typicall pay for all 90 days in advance and may have the option to renew 1 time depending on the carrier. So Short term is really designed for a know ammount of time, that an individual or family will be with out health insurance.

Temporary Health Insurance is designed for individuals that need coverage right away but have no idea how long they will need it, as it is designed to be more of a month to month type of protection until you get in your permanate plan.

International Travel medical insurance is great to understand because many traditional plans do not cover you internationally or may call it out-of-network and give you reduced benefits. Travel medical insurance also includes other benefits like evacuation, lost pasport, translation and many other benefits a international traveler needs.

G.A.P Coverage is designed to pick up the slack where your traditional plan leaves off, like the deductible, co-pays and other items not covered by your insurance carrier like Wigs for cancer patients, traveling to a hospital with better facilities for your condition and a place for a loved one to stay while with you in your time of need.

Centuries Old The original idea of health insurance was brought into being by Hugh Chamberlen in 1694. By the time the 1800`s rolled around, people were able to buy accident insurance, which worked to help those who were injured in an accident or who ended up disabled.

The very first health plans only offered compensation if the victim was injured due to an accident on a steamboat or train. While not terribly useful, since there were more injuries related to other circumstances at the time, it did prepare people for the more comprehensive types of plans that would be developed later on by health insurance Canada companies.

In 1847, the Massachusetts Health Insurance of Boston offered the very first group insurance policy with comprehensive benefits. By the 1890`s, insurance companies were starting to issue individual policies that covered everything from injuries and accidents to sickness and disease.

Health Insurance During the War Group insurance plans as we know them today didn`t start until 1929 when a group of teachers decided to create their own plan. They worked a deal with the Baylor Hospital in Dallas, Texas where they would pay a monthly fee in exchange for medical attention and recovery care whenever needed, for any member of the group.

The idea went over so well that it wasn`t long before Blue Cross health plans were designed. These were health plans that were negotiated specifically with the local hospitals or even specific doctors. Discounts were given to the plan holders and the entire process worked very well.

By the 1940`s, it was evident that more than these very basic types of health insurance was necessary. Some people couldn't afford the monthly fees, but were still in need of the protection afforded by having insurance. This is when employee health insurance became common. Employers would negotiate a deal for their workers and while you worked in a specific workplace, you were covered by their health plan.

During the Second World War, there was a wage freeze. No one was allowed to offer higher wages, which made it virtually impossible to lure the best worker to your company. With so many men away from the country fighting, getting the remaining workers available because a war in and of itself. Health benefits became the new lure and before the war ended in 1945, hundreds of businesses were offering comprehensive health packages in exchange for working for them.

Modern Times, Modern Plans In the 50`s and 60`s, the government began to take an interest in health care and social security began to include disability insurance in 1954. Medicare and Medicaid were both created in the mid-60`s and by the 90`s, most Americans were enrolled in a managed care health insurance program. How can you create a meal that isn't a repeat of the same old plate? The trick to creating a new dish is to think about what ingredients you are working with, not just the finished dish.

1) Old Fashioned Potato Soup

When you have leftover mashed potatoes, you have the makings for a wonderfully creamy potato soup. Start with a big soup pot. Throw in 3 or 4 slices of bacon, diced, and cook until the pieces are crispy, then remove from pot. In the same pot, cook up some diced celery and carrots. Then add some diced onion and cook until soft. Then put in about 1 Tablespoon of oil, 1 Tablespoon of flour, and 1 1/2 cups of milk, and thicken. Stir in your potatoes and bacon and simmer very slowly. This is a very satisfying creamy potato soup.

2) Turkey And Gravy Barbeque Style

Take white and dark turkey meat and dice into small pieces or shred up. In a big, heavy skillet, saute some bacon pieces until soft. Add chopped onion and minced garlic, simmering until just fragrant. Now put the cut up turkey in the skillet, and pour over enough leftover gravy to make the turkey a little soupy. Then just flavor the gravy with a little bit of barbeque sauce or dry grilling rub spice, using only enough to make the gravy taste tangy. Cook slowly until nice and hot and pungent. Serve on a leftover dinner roll or any bun.

3) Curry Turkey Cauliflower Soup

Place cooked cauliflower into a food processor and blend until smooth, drizzling in milk until you reach a smooth, soupy consistency. Put about 2 teaspoons of curry in as you blend. You may want more or less curry, so start slowly. In a heavy pot, drizzle a little oil and cook some chopped carrots and onion until just tender. Add your creamy cauliflower mixture to pot. You may now add some cut up turkey that you have leftover. Cook the soup slowly until heated through.

4) Cheesy Green Bean Tomato Soup

If you have leftover green bean casserole, you're in luck. It makes the perfect start for a cheese soup. Adding some diced tomatoes gives this soup a fresh flavor. Get out your big soup pot and saute up some bite size pieces of celery until just soft. Add several big chunks of onion, cooking until transparent, and then add a little minced garlic. Pour in a can of diced tomatoes. You may want a little extra seasoning, like a grill seasoning or dry rub. Put in your green bean casserole, slowly mixing in all the ingredients. If it seems a little thick, add a bit of chicken broth. Now just heat, stirring often, until the soup is all creamy and hot.

5) Egg And Stuffing Breakfast

Prepare a muffin tin by spraying with non-stick spray or rubbing each muffin cup with butter or oil. Spoon stuffing into muffin cups and push up the sides to form little stuffing cups. Break one egg into each cup. Then top with shredded cheese, either cheddar or Parmesan. Cook in a 350 degree oven for around 15 to 20 minutes, just until the cheese is melted and golden brown and the egg is cooked. Be sure to let the muffin tin cool a little after you take it out of the oven before you remove the egg dish.
